Bazar Ramadan is a night market set up solely during the month of Ramadan to sell ready-cooked food. It is organized and supported by the government. It is very popular and convenient to Muslims as they can just buy food or "tapau" food and bring back home to eat during the breaking of fast (or buka puasa). After a hard day at work with fasting, Muslims can just stop by the roadside to buy packed food, so they do not have to do the tedious work of cooking when they reach home. Some locations of Bazar Ramadan are huge, with a long row of stalls, such as Bazaar Ramadan at Putrajaya, Bangsar and TTDI which are well known. Bazar Ramadan is just like a night market and is popular not only with Muslims who are fasting but also with non-Muslims of other races. Malaysia is a multicultural society, so we, the citizens (or rakyat) just love to eat food from different cultures.
